Arrowhead's 2024 shooter moves the original's top-down co-op to third person and keeps everything that made it funny and lethal. Four players drop onto a planet, call in equipment by punching in code sequences on a stratagem pad, and are constantly at risk from each other - friendly fire is always on, an orbital laser does not care who is standing in it, and a badly thrown supply pod will flatten a teammate. The satire is Starship Troopers played entirely straight, with managed democracy and mandatory patriotism delivered without a wink. Its real innovation is the Galactic War: a persistent front where the whole playerbase's mission outcomes decide which planets are held, run in real time by a designer nicknamed the Game Master who escalates in response to what players do. That produced genuine communal events, including a Terminid outbreak nobody planned for. It sold enormously, weathered a public fight over account linking, and has kept adding factions and stratagems since.
